Your search - ecology finding innovation can demand 10 communication costs de developpement en afrique.~ - did not match any resources.

Perhaps you should try some spelling variations:
finding innovation » linking innovation, finding innovative, winning innovation
10 communication » 1 communication, de communication, 3 communication
de developpement » sme development
developpement en » developpement et, developpement des, developpement de
ecology finding » ecology linking, ecology foraging
innovation can » innovation case, innovation cases, innovation 1
can demand » car demand, chain demand, loan demand
demand 10 » demands 10, demand 1, demand 1909
costs de » costs _, costs 4, costs a

You may be able to get more results by adjusting your search query.